People are wary of survey, says TDP

Qutbullapur MLA (TDP) Vivekananda Goud on Wednesday said that people were having many doubts and anxieties about the proposed household survey on August 19. He told reporters that the government did not make any attempt to remove the doubts. He said Chief Minister K.Chandrasekhar Rao had earlier promised in the State Assembly that all parties would be consulted on any important issue, but there was no connection between his words and deeds.

Observing that it was not proper for the government to act in a dictatorial fashion, he wanted the government to discuss the issue with all parties. He said people would teach befitting lesson if it acted unilaterally.
